湖北文理学院专业实验专项技能实验报告.doc

上传人:m**** 文档编号:522577183 上传时间:2023-11-14 格式:DOC 页数:13 大小:620.45KB
返回 下载 相关 举报
湖北文理学院专业实验专项技能实验报告.doc_第1页
第1页 / 共13页
湖北文理学院专业实验专项技能实验报告.doc_第2页
第2页 / 共13页
湖北文理学院专业实验专项技能实验报告.doc_第3页
第3页 / 共13页
湖北文理学院专业实验专项技能实验报告.doc_第4页
第4页 / 共13页
湖北文理学院专业实验专项技能实验报告.doc_第5页
第5页 / 共13页
点击查看更多>>
资源描述

《湖北文理学院专业实验专项技能实验报告.doc》由会员分享,可在线阅读,更多相关《湖北文理学院专业实验专项技能实验报告.doc(13页珍藏版)》请在金锄头文库上搜索。

1、实验一一、实验目的熟悉掌握VISIO绘图工具二、实验要求绘制2-3个复杂的图形三、实验内容用VISIO软件绘制基础工业工程(易树平主编)教材P15页图1-9图形和图p99页图4-39图四、实验结果实验结果如下图:实验二一、实验目的学习和掌握运用软件解决规划问题。二、实验要求要求掌握该软件的编程方法,用该软件解决一类复杂题目求出其解。三、实验内容用LINDO或GLPS软件解决运筹学教材中的多目标规划问题(或其它规划问题)的解。四、实验过程及结果求解下面整数规划问题:某昼夜服务的公交线路每天各时间段内所需司机和乘务人员数如下:班次时间所需人数16:00-10:0060210:00-14:00703

2、14:00-18:0060418:00-22:0050522:00-2:002062:00-6:0030解:设xk(k=1,2,3,4,5,6)表示xk名司机和乘务人员第k 班次开始上班。由题意,有Min Z=x1+x2+x3+x4+x5+x6x6+x160x1+x270x2+x360x3+x450x4+x520x5+x630x1,x2,x3,x4,x5,x60实验三一、实验目的学习掌握计算机仿真的基本原理,对所给出的问题建模,写出其算法,并得出解二、实验要求要求对所给出的问题建模,写出其算法,并得出解。三、实验内容用系统建模与仿真的方法编写中国期刊网中的论文“基于故障树分析法的供应链可靠性诊

3、断与仿真研究”一文中的算法,并求其解。四、实验过程及结果(1)编写如下C语言程序: #include stdio.h #include time.h#include math.h#include stdlib.h#define Nmax 50000 float ran( ) long rand(); long i; float r; i=rand(); r=i/32767.0; return r; int main()long Tc1=0,Tz1=0,Tz2=0,Tg11=0,Tg13=0,Tg14=0,Tg16=0,Tg24=0,Tg26=0,Tg28=0,Tg31=0,Tg33=0,Tg3

4、4=0,Tf11=0,Tf12=0,Tf15=0,Tf16=0,Tf21=0,Tf25=0,Tf26=0,T=0,c=0,z=0,g=0,g1=0,g2=0,g3=0,f=0,f1=0,f2=0,N=0,TN=0; float c1=0,z1=0,z2=0,g11=0,g13=0,g14=0,g16=0,g24=0,g26=0,g28=0,g31=0,g33=0,g34=0,f11=0,f12=0,f15=0,f16=0,f21=0,f25=0,f26=0,GZD; srand(unsigned)time(NULL); for(N=1;N=0.03& c1=0.39&g11=0.08&g13=

5、0.12&g14=0.15&g16=1) g1=1; else g1=0; g24=ran();g26=ran();g28=ran(); if(g24=0.04&g24=0.18&g26=0.10&g28=1) g2=1; else g2=0; g31=ran();g33=ran();g34=ran(); if(g31=0.08&g31=0.17&g31=0.060&g34=1) g3=1; else g3=0; if(g1+g2+g3)=3) g=1;T=T+1;Tg11=Tg11+g11;Tg13=Tg13+g13;Tg14=Tg14+g14;Tg16=Tg16+g16; Tg24=Tg2

6、4+g24;Tg26=Tg26+g26;Tg28=Tg28+g28; Tg31=Tg31+g31;Tg33=Tg33+g33;Tg34=Tg34+g34; continue; else g=0; if(c1=1) g31=ran();g33=ran();g34=ran(); if(g31=0.08&g31=0.17&g31=0.060&g34=1) g=1;T=T+1;Tg31=Tg31+g31;Tg33=Tg33+g33;Tg34=Tg34+g34;Tc1=Tc1+1; continue; else g=0; z1=ran();z2=ran(); if(z1=0.020) z1=1;T=T+

7、1;Tz1=Tz1+z1;continue; else z1=0; if(z2=0.034&f11=0.14&f12=0.012&f15=0.010&f16=1) f1=1; else f1=0; f21=ran();f25=ran();f26=ran(); if(f21=0.010&f21=0.026&f25=0.14&f26=1) f2=1; else f2=0; if(f1+f2)=2) f=1;T=T+1;Tf11=Tf11+f11;Tf12=Tf12+f12;Tf15=Tf15+f15;Tf16=Tf16+f16; Tf21=Tf21+f21;Tf25=Tf25+f25;Tf26=T

8、f26+f26; continue; else TN+; GZD=(float)T/Nmax; c1=(float)Tc1/T;z1=(float)Tz1/T;z2=(float)Tz2/T; g11=(float)Tg11/T;g13=(float)Tg13/T;g14=(float)Tg14/T;g16=(float)Tg16/T;g24=(float)Tg24/T; g26=(float)Tg26/T;g28=(float)Tg28/T;g31=(float)Tg31/T;g33=(float)Tg33/T; g34=(float)Tg34/T; f11=(float)Tf11/T;f1

9、2=(float)Tf12/T;f15=(float)Tf15/T;f16=(float)Tf16/T; f21=(float)Tf21/T;f25=(float)Tf25/T;f26=(float)Tf26/T; printf(T=%ld,TN=%ldn,T,TN); printf(GZD=%fn,GZD); printf(The importance of each elementn); printf(c1=%f,z1=%f,z2=%fn,c1,z1,z2); printf(g11=%f,g13=%f,g14=%f,g16=%fn,g11,g13,g14,g16); printf(g24=%f,g26=%f,g28=%fn,g24,g26,g28); printf(g31=%f,g33=%f,g34=%fn,g31,g33,g34); printf(f11=%f,f12=%f,f15=%f,f16=%fn,f11,f12,f15,f16); printf(f21=%f,f25=%f,f2

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> IT计算机/网络 > 服务器

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号